    I lived in India from 1984-2005, and wrote to my parents regularly about my adventures in Indian ashrams. From 1984-1993 and again 2001-2005, I was living in Puttaparthi, Andhra Pradesh, and I am adding all of those my "Letters from India" book, which will mainly be of interest to those familiar with Prasanthi Nilayam, the ashram of Sri Sathya Sai Baba. However, from 1994-2001 I was staying at a wonderfully spiritual, quiet retreat called Shanti Ashram, and I am putting the letters I wrote to my parents while staying there, on this book. The ashram was a dream come true for sadhana. The people are welcoming, it is usually never crowded, and they offer separate cottages to aspirants. The rates are donation basis only.
